How much does it cost to fly private from Boston to London?


How much does it cost to fly private from Boston to London? The price starts from $80,000 to $90,000 one way for a given route. Another option is a heavy jet whose rental starts from $90,000 to $110,000. You can also decide on an ultra-long-range jet. Its rental starts at $110,000 to $130,000 one way for the route.

How much is a private jet from Miami to London?

We recommend a heavy jet due to the long-distance across the North Atlantic Ocean between London and Miami airports. The cost of a private flight aboard a heavier jet, such as a Gulfstream G550, averages at around $93,600 to $109,200.


How rich do you need to be to own a private jet?

However, they also noted that it will typically cost $500,000 to $1 million a year just to operate a private jet. This means that a private jet owner will probably need at least $10 million in income per year to afford to become a jet setting jet owner.


Is it cheaper to fly on a private plane?

It is more expensive to fly on a private jet than it is to buy a seat on a commercial flight. But there are ways to make it more affordable than a straight private jet charter. It can be more affordable to fly privately if the cost is shared among all the passengers or by booking a flight on an empty leg.


Do you need a passport for a private jet?

So, do you need a passport if you fly private? If you are flying to an international destination, then the answer is yes. Every international country and nation requires travelers to produce a passport before entering. If you do not have a valid passport, they will not grant you entry.

What to expect when flying private?

When you fly private, you can expect no security lines, no baggage check-in, and no waiting for hours in the terminal. You can also expect comfort, privacy, and flying on your own schedule.

Can you buy a seat on a private jet?

Seat sharing services allow travellers to buy seats on a per person basis, on a private aircraft, whether it's on a bespoke charter flight or on a pre-determined route (a shuttle). This can bring the cost of the flight down considerably.


Why is private flying so expensive?

When you fly privately, the cost is typically shouldered by just one or two passengers. The hourly costs to charter a private jet include the cost of fuel, aircraft maintenance, crew wages, and more.


How risky is private flying?

On a commercial aircraft, there are fewer than 0.01 fatalities per 100,000 hours of flying. On a private plane, that number jumps to 2.3 fatalities per 100,000 hours flown.
